RETURN OF SHEEP INSPECTED IN THE PROVINCE OF CANTERBURY DURING THE MONTH OF FEBRUARY, 1862.
| DATE OF INSPECTION | DATE OF PRECEDING INSPECTION | NAME OF STATION | WHERE SITUATE | NAME OF MANAGER OR OWNER | NO. OF SHEEP STATION | NO. OF SHEEP INSPECTED | RESULT | DATE ON WHICH SHEEP WERE LAST DRESSED | REMARKS |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| February 13 | ... | The Wolds | Takepo | W. H. Ostler | ... | 3000 | 3000 | Scabby | ... |
| February 22 | ... | Double Corner | Waipara | L. Walker | ... | 9000 | 2000 | Scabby | ... |
| February 24 | ... | North Bank of the Hurunui | Nelson | W. Shrimpton* | ... | β | 3200 | Clean | ... |
| February 25 | ... | Glenmark | Waipara | G. H. Moore | ... | β | 1700 | Clean | ... |
Christchurch, 11th March, 1862.
P. B. BOULTON, Inspector of Sheep.
DECLARATION
I, Walter Shrimpton, of Sandford Downs, Province of Nelson, do hereby solemnly declare that the sheep, 3200 in number, marked J F, now being depastured by me on the North Bank of the Hurunui, have not within three months last past had applied to any of them any reputed scab-destroying preparation, nor been mixed with any sheep infected with scab or catarrh; and I make this solemn declaration, conscientiously believing the sazno to be true.
WALTER SHRIMPTON.
Declared before me, at Hasties, this 24th day of February, 1862.
P. B. BOULTON, Inspector of Sheep.
CERTIFICATE OF INSPECTOR
I, Philip Baker Boulton, Inspector of Sheep, hereby certify that I have carefully examined 3200 sheep, branded J F, the property of Walter Shrimpton, now being depastured on the North Bank of the Hurunui, and that I find such sheep entirely free from scab or catarrh.
Given under my hand, at Hasties, this 24th day of February, 1862.
P. B. BOULTON, Inspector of Sheep.
